Hi Marina, we’re so appreciative of you taking the time to share your nuggets of wisdom with our community. One of the topics we think is most important for folks looking to level up their lives is building up their self-confidence and self-esteem. Can you share how you developed your confidence?

I developed my confidence by learning to listen to myself and staying true to my values and passions. There was a time when I worked in jobs that didn’t resonate with me, which made me feel small and constantly afraid of being called out for not being in my element. This experience taught me the importance of aligning my work and life choices with my genuine interests and strengths.

The turning point came when I decided to stop betraying myself. I made a conscious effort to pursue only the things I genuinely enjoy and excel at. I surrounded myself with like-minded, positive people who uplift and inspire me. By making these changes, I created an environment where I could thrive and grow.

Confidence, for me, stems from this authenticity. When you honor your true self and make choices that reflect your inner values, you naturally feel more secure and empowered. It’s about respecting your own boundaries and desires, and this integrity builds a solid foundation for self-assurance.

There is so much advice out there about all the different skills and qualities folks need to develop in order to succeed in today’s highly competitive environment and often it can feel overwhelming. So, if we had to break it down to just the three that matter most, which three skills or qualities would you focus on?

Reflecting on my journey, three qualities have been particularly impactful: intuition, the ability to see the big picture, and viewing each person as their highest version.

1. **Intuition**: Trusting my intuition has been a cornerstone of my success. This inner guidance has helped me make decisions that align with my values and long-term goals. For those early in their journey, I recommend honing this skill by regularly reflecting on your experiences and paying attention to your gut feelings. Journaling and mindfulness practices can also help you connect with your intuitive side.

2. **Seeing the Big Picture**: Understanding the broader context of any situation has allowed me to strategize effectively and make informed decisions. Developing this skill involves constantly learning and staying curious about different aspects of your field. Try to see how various elements interconnect and consider the long-term implications of your actions. Reading widely and seeking diverse perspectives can greatly enhance your ability to see the big picture.

3. **Viewing Each Person as Their Highest Version**: Recognizing and valuing the potential in others has been crucial in building strong, positive relationships and creating a supportive work environment. To cultivate this quality, practice empathy and active listening. Focus on others’ strengths and encourage them to reach their full potential. This approach not only builds confidence in others but also fosters a collaborative and empowering atmosphere.

For those starting out, my advice is to embrace these qualities and continuously seek opportunities for growth. Surround yourself with mentors and peers who inspire you, and always be open to learning and adapting. By nurturing your intuition, broadening your perspective, and uplifting those around you, you’ll be well-equipped to navigate your journey with confidence and success.
